The Car recovery London Diaries
Car recovery products and services in London are An important facet of car or truck maintenance and emergency help for drivers in the town. Whether it's a breakdown, an accident, or simply a car that won't start off, recovery companies are meant to provide rapid and productive alternatives. Every time a car or truck activities mechanical failure or